contract net protocol
Recently Published Documents


TOTAL DOCUMENTS

92
(FIVE YEARS 9)

H-INDEX

10
(FIVE YEARS 1)

Author(s):  
Saber Ikram ◽  
El Bachtiri Rachid ◽  
Bendali Wadie ◽  
Boussetta Mohammed ◽  
El hammoumi Karima ◽  
...  

Algorithms ◽  
2019 ◽  
Vol 12 (4) ◽  
pp. 70 ◽  
Author(s):  
Jiarui Zhang ◽  
Gang Wang ◽  
Yafei Song

Background: The existing contract net protocol has low overall efficiency during the bidding and release period, and a large amount of redundant information is generated during the negotiation process. Methods: On the basis of an ant colony algorithm, the dynamic response threshold model and the flow of pheromone model were established, then the complete task allocation process was designed. Three experimental settings were simulated under different conditions. Results: When the number of agents was 20 and the maximum load value was L max = 3 , the traffic and run-time of task allocation under the improved contract net protocol decreased. When the number of tasks and L max was fixed, the improved contract net protocol had advantages over the dynamic contract net and classical contract net protocols in terms of both traffic and run-time. Setting up the number of agents, tasks and L max to improve the task allocation under the contract net not only minimizes the number of errors, but also the task completion rate reaches 100%. Conclusions: The improved contract net protocol can reduce the traffic and run-time compared with classical contract net and dynamic contract net protocols. Furthermore, the algorithm can achieve better assignment results and can re-forward all erroneous tasks.


Sign in / Sign up

Export Citation Format

Share Document